    Description

    HealthCare Associates Credit Union (a $460M credit union based out of Naperville, IL) is seeking a dedicated Cloud Engineer who is respon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ining our multi-cloud infrastructure to support a range of business applications and services. This role will act as a key player in ensuring our cloud environments are secure, reliable, and optimized for performance. It requires a deep understanding of various cloud platforms, the ability to troubleshoot and resolve complex issues, and the flexibility to work across multiple technologies and tools.

    Interested? Here's more about the role:

    Responsibilities:

    Information Technologies Support:
    • Deploy, configure, and maintain cloud resources, ensuring high availability and optimal performance.
    • Implement and monitor security best practices, compliance standards, and disaster recovery strategies for cloud services.
    • Design, deploy, and support cloud technologies including, but not limited to, Azure, RingCentral, Jira, Confluence, M365, Entra ID, Microsoft Defender, and Intune
    • Develop cloud architecture and designs to meet the organization's business needs, taking into account scalability, security, and performance.
    • Collaborate with various teams to integrate cloud services with other on-premises and cloud systems, ensuring seamless operations.
    • Monitor cloud resources, analyze performance, and implement optimization strategies to reduce costs and improve efficiency.
    • Create and maintain automation scripts and infrastructure-as-code (IaC) to streamline deployment and management processes.
    • Diagnose and resolve complex IT issues and provide 24/7 support when necessary.
    • Create and maintain comprehensive documentation of cloud architecture, configurations, standard operating procedures (SOPs), technical architectural Visio drawings, and best practices.
    • Assist in training and mentoring junior team members and cross-functional teams on cloud-related technologies.
    • Provide Level 3 technical support to end-users, diagnose and resolve hardware and software issues, and ensure a high level of member satisfaction.
    • Perform root cause analysis and implement solutions to prevent future occurrences.
    • Use ITSM software (Jira) and tools to collect agreed performance statistics and to ensure that appropriate action is taken to investigate and resolve incidents in systems and service.
    • Participate on projects with a focus on smoothing the transition from development staff (Senior Network Administrators, Analysts, Management, etc.) to production staff (end-users) by performing quality testing, documentation, and cross-training within the project life-cycle.
    Banking Systems Administration
    • Maintain and administer banking application environments, including but not limited to Symitar Episys, iPay Bill Pay, Vertifi DeposZip, Microdynamics Group/OSG eStatements, Alkami ORB (online relationship builder), MeridianLink's XpressAccounts, DocuSign, CUNA Mutual LoanLiner, and SWBC EasyPay.
    • Fully vet with quality assurance testing updates, patches, and new releases for banking applications including formal documentation of QA checklists and release summaries for staff.
    • Identify and resolve issues with applications, automated tools, network scripts and group policies.
    • Create, change, and remove third-party security access for end-users as requested by management.
    • Participate in the development and implementation of software related procedures and standards.
    Development
    •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including developers, system administrators, and DevOps engineers, to deliver integrated solutions.
    • Provide guidance and support to internal teams on Azure-related matters.
    • Offer business process recommendations to IT management on effective usage of systems and technologies to utilize their fullest potential.
    • Participate on project implementations including requirements gathering, validation, beta testing, user acceptance performance, deployment, and project closing debrief.
    • Contribute to project plans, schedules and track and report project statuses.
    • Assist in communicating and documenting requirements of projects with departments, programmers, networking team, and vendors in a clear and organized fashion.
    • Act as liaison between department end-users, analysts, networking team, and consultants in the analysis, design, configuration, testing, and maintenance of systems and processes to ensure optimal operational performance.
